MHP wrote more than 9,400 tickets over Labor Day weekend

MISSISSIPPI (WCBI) – It was a deadly Labor Day weekend across Mississippi, with seven deadly accidents and over 9,400 tickets written. The Mississippi Highway Patrol says there were 184 DUI arrests in the state. 519 of the tickets were for a seat belt violation. Troopers investigated 121 accidents.
